Transaction 152990d29df7e65c67bce70408297071bde50912cb735438e73f667e05128469
1 Input
2 Outputs
- 152990d29df7e65c67bce70408297071bde50912cb735438e73f667e05128469:0
- 152990d29df7e65c67bce70408297071bde50912cb735438e73f667e05128469:1
value 24563569
address 36TQeDUSzkvXE6bx3FdFAyJ7aCDPACi9ZF
value 15824707
address 17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c